The University of Arkansas at Little Rock is a metropolitan research university that provides an accessible, quality education through flexible learning and unparalleled internship opportunities. At UA Little Rock, we prepare our more than 8,900 students to be innovators and responsible leaders in their fields. Committed to its metropolitan research university mission, UA Little Rock is a driving force in Little Rock's thriving cultural community and a major component of the city and state's growing profile as a regional leader in research, technology transfer, economic development, and job creation.

Summary of Job Duties:The Admissions Counselor - Recruiter will be responsible for managing the University's undergraduate student recruitment efforts in an assigned territory and other areas as designated. This position is governed by state and federal laws, and agency/institution policy. Qualifications:

Required Education and Experience

  • Bachelor's degree is required with at least two (2) years of experience in admissions/recruitment procedures, customer service, marketing, or related field.
Job Duties and Responsibilities
  • Cultivate and maintain relationships with high school counselors and community college representatives;
  • Travel to and represent the university at high schools and community colleges by recruiting students, attending college fairs, and presenting at college-day events;
  • Communicate effectively with prospective students regarding important dates, deadlines, missing credentials, and enrollment information via email, phone, text, social media, and in-person meetings;
  • Plan and participate in on- and off-campus recruiting events;
  • Develop and strengthen partnerships within the community;
  • Support the development of recruitment strategies and projects;
  • Collaborate with other campus departments and offices on recruitment activities;
  • Track and report on recruiting activities;
  • Guide prospective students and visitors through the UA Little Rock application process for admission, financial aid, and the Workday student database system;
  • Provide comprehensive information to students and visitors about UA Little Rock, admissions requirements, and undergraduate programs of study;
  • Conduct campus tours for prospective students and their families;
  • Perform data entry and review admission documents such as high school transcripts, college transcripts, test scores (ACT, SAT, Accuplacer), immunization records, letters of good standing, letters of non-attendance, permission letters from parents and school officials to ensure compliance with the university admissionstandards;
  • Determine applicant admissibility to the University and render admission decisions;
  • Utilize official websites to verify the accreditation of colleges attended by transfer applicants and to confirm enrollment at previous institutions;
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
  • Extensive knowledge of the student enrollment lifecycle, from application submissions to final enrollment;
  • Proficiency in managing large datasets and interacting with central administrative systems. Ability to read maps and give directions;
  • Strong command of internet and standard office technologies, including email, search engines, and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Access);
  • Exceptional organ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ple concurrent tasks and documents;
  • Skill in maintaining well-organized project files and documentation;
  • Flexibility to work varied hours, including nights, weekends, and holidays;
  • Proactive and self-motivated, capable of initiating tasks under general supervision;
  • Superior verbal and written communication skills, essential for explaining complex information to diverse audiences;
  • Excellent public speaking and presentation abilities;
  • Aptitude for crafting concise reports or narratives to interpret data results or explain their significance;
  • Valid driver's license and the ability to operate a motor vehicle;
  • Willingness and ability to travel, including overnight and out-of-state trips.
